Abstract

Embodiments of a tie plate sorter are disclosed wherein the tie plates are sorted and fed to an output device for further feeding to a tie plate distribution system. The tie plates may be oriented as needed. Exemplary methods are also provided.

Claims (29)

1. A tie plate sorter assembly, comprising:

a tie plate receiver having a first end and a second end;

at least one location which receives tie plates into said tie plate receiver;

said tie plate receiver having at least one side extending between said first and second ends defining an interior of said tie plate receiver wherein said tie plates are deposited;

said tie plate receiver having at least one aperture discharging tie plates;

a plurality of magnets disposed about said receiver adjacent to said at least one side of said receiver, to magnetically retain said tie plates and release said tie plates through said at least one aperture.

2.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 1 further comprising a mechanical structure to engage or disengage said plurality of magnets.

3.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 2 , said plurality of magnets retaining said tie plates in said receiver until said magnet is disengaged.

4.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 1 wherein said plurality of magnets are electromagnets.

5.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 4 wherein said plurality of magnets are actuated electrically.

6.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 1 further comprising a pocket wherein at least one of said plurality of tie plates is seated.

7.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 6 wherein each of said plurality of magnets are positioned adjacent to said pocket.

8.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 6 wherein said aperture is formed adjacent to said pocket.

9.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 1 wherein said plurality of magnets are actuated mechanically.

10.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 1 wherein said plurality of magnets are actuated depending on the position of said tie plate sorter.

11. A tie plate sorter assembly, comprising:

a tie plate receiver having a generally cylindrical shape including a first axial end and a second axial end;

an input location which receives tie plates to an interior of said tie plate receiver;

a plurality of circumferentially spaced pockets about said receiver;

a retaining mechanism located adjacent to said pockets to retain at least one of said tie plates in said pocket;

an aperture in said pocket such that said retaining mechanism selectively releases said at least one of said tie plates.

12.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 11 , said aperture discharging said at least one tie plate externally of said receiver.

13.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 12 further comprising a conveyor to receive said discharged at least one tie plate.

14.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 11 , said pockets extending in an axial direction.

15.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 11 wherein said at least one retaining mechanism is magnetic.

16.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 11 wherein said at least one retaining mechanism is electromagnetic.

17.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 11 wherein said at least one retaining mechanism is actuated depending on the position of said tie plate sorter.

18.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 11 wherein said at least one retaining mechanism is actuated electrically.

19. The tie plate sorter assembly of claim 11 wherein said at least one retaining mechanism is actuated mechanically.
